免费空间

DirectAdmin免费PHP空间启用Redis缓存加速和网站每日备份与恢复

挖站否DirectAdmin免费PHP空间,采用CN2线路,速度相对于普通的美国空间来说要快了不少,而且主机上安装并启用了Redis服务:DirectAdmin空间启用OpCache和redis缓存加速,有需要运行Redis的朋友可以调用Redis缓存来加速网站了。

由于是免费PHP空间,一个IP上有上百个网站,虽然在申请免费空间前已经提示用户不要有违反相关规定的操作,但还是发现了部分用户不遵守规则,比较严重的一次是机房清空了DirectAdmin免费PHP空间服务器的IP路由,这次事件后定期检查域名还是非常重要的。

之所以要提起服务器宕机的事情,主要提醒使用DirectAdmin免费PHP空间的用户做到每日一备份,以避免用户数据的损失。这篇文章就来分享一下如何在DirectAdmin免费PHP空间上启用Redis缓存(Wordpress为例),同时如何做好免费空间的文件备份工作。

更多的免费资源请参考:

  1. 免费域名.tk,.ml,.ga,.cf,.gq申请注册和DNS解析-绑定免费空间教程
  2. Oracle Cloud甲骨文免费VPS主机申请使用-日本,韩国和美国等免费云VPS主机
  3. CloudFlare免费CDN加速-CloudFlare加速,DNS解析,SSL证书和防DDoS攻击

PS:更新记录:

1.挖站否DA空间已经默认启用Redis缓存了,下载并启用Redis Object Cache插件后,按照五、多站点启用Redis缓存这一步操作添加自定义WP_CACHE_KEY_SALT就可以了。2020.9.21

2.如果你的 DirectAdmin 用户比较多且网站流量大的话容量出现Mysql数据库问题,参考: 破除MySQL打开的文件描述符限制-数据库Too many open files问题 。2019.12.27

一、免费PHP空间介绍

网站:

  1. https://manage.qyfou.com/cart.php?gid=7
  2. 注册码:https://wzfou.com/jifen/14379.html/
  3. 论坛讨论:https://wzfou.com/question/17268/
  4. 服务状态:https://node.wzfou.com/

免费空间配置是:容量1GB;月流量是10GB(若正常建站流量不够用请发工单免费增加);FTP账户:1个;数据库:3个;服务器Linux+Apache 2.4+PHP 7.2(可选PHP 7.0 PHP 7.1 PHP 7.3)+MysqL。

申请免费空间前请仔细阅读使用说明:挖站否美国1GB免费PHP空间-CN2线路速度快中文DirectAdmin面板。如果有能力的话,你也可以单独购买DA面板架构在自己的服务器提供免费服务给别人使用:DirectAdmin面板安装使用教程

二、启用Redis缓存加速

2.1 安装插件

插件:

  1. https://cn.wordpress.org/plugins/redis-cache/

在你的Wordpress后台搜索并下载Redis Object Cache

点击Redis Object Cache设置,先暂时不要启用。

2.2 创建Redis

进入到DirectAdmin免费PHP空间,点击Redis管理。

新版的DirectAdmin可以在附加功能中找到。

点击新建Redis,这时会生成密码,记录下来。

2.3 配置Redis

打开你的Wordpress的wp-config.php文件,在最前方一行加入以下代码(注意替换Key为你在DA空间中创建的密码):

define( 'WP_CACHE_KEY_SALT', 'wzfou.com' );

如下图:

现在在你的WP的Redis Object Cache设置中,点击开启Redis缓存。这时我们可以看到Wordpress Redis缓存开启成功了。

2.4 加速效果

以挖站否的演示站为例:cn2host.wzfou.net,未开启Redis缓存前,数据库查询为20个左右。

开启了Redis缓存后,数据查询降为4个左右,效果还是非常明显的。

三、免费空间备份恢复

关于DirectAdmin备份与恢复功能,我在cPanel和DirectAdmin面板备份和恢复方法已经介绍过,这篇文章主要目的还是在于提醒DirectAdmin免费空间的朋友记得备份。

3.1 手动备份

在DirectAdmin首页可以找到用户备份与恢复选项。

如果你用的是DirectAdmin新的界面,是在“高级功能”里找到备份与恢复功能,接下来的操作基本一样。

创建备份。这里可以备份所有的设置与文件,例如Mysql数据库、网站文件、邮件配置以及FTP设置等等。

3.2 备份恢复

备份完成后,你可以点击查看你的备份文件,将它们下载到本地,同时也可以选择恢复。

点击查看备份文件,会跳转到DirectAdmin的文件管理器,这里点击就可以将备份的文件下载到本地了。

解压压缩包,你的网站根目录的所有文件在如下路径:

你的Mysql数据库在如下路径:

下载下来的备份文件建议放在网盘或者云存储当中:巧用又拍云FTP和坚果云WebDAV-打造个人文件备份和数据云存储

四、总结

由于DirectAdmin官方并没有直接安装Redis组件的方式,所以目前在DirectAdmin启用Redis的方式只能使用第三方的Redis插件,还有很多的地方不兼容,包括设置Redis端口、密码等存在不少的问题。

由于DirectAdmin Redis为多用户共享,所以只能采取指定Redis Key的方式来启用。大家在Wordpress启用Redis前一定要在配置文件中指定key。最后,提醒大家使用免费空间一定要做每日一备份。

文章出自:挖站否 https://wzfou.com/da-redis-backup/,版权所有。本站文章除注明出处外,皆为作者原创文章,可自由引用,但请注明来源。

文章更新于: 2020年9月26日 下午8:46

Qi

关于站长(Qi),2008年开始混迹于免费资源圈中,有幸结识了不少的草根站长。之后自己摸爬滚打潜心学习Web服务器、VPS、域名等,兴趣广泛,杂而不精,但愿将自己经验与心得分享出来与大家共勉。

查看评论